/*
|
||
|
* This helper program is needed for the Visual Studio compiler
|
||
|
* to find out the standard macros, there is no "gcc -dM -E -".
|
||
|
* A trick is used to find out the standard macros. You can
|
||
|
* exchange the compiler. The standard macros are written in
|
||
|
* a enviroment variable. This helper programm analysis this
|
||
|
* variable and prints the output to stdout.
|
||
|
*/
